Such sad news today worsened by this article found on a French jihadi forum:

Al-Qaeda in Iraq announces having executed the two American soldiers


PARIS - Al Qaeda in Iraq has announced having executed the two American soldiers whose bodies were found south of Baghdad, "by slitting their throats", in a communiqué online Tuesday on the Internet.

"We announce the good news, from the battlefield, to the Islamic nation (...). The two Crusaders taken hostage have been executed by slitting their throats", declares the official statement put on an Islamic site and signed by the media department of the Mujahideen Shura Council, an alliance of eight jihadist groups dominated by the Iraqi branch of Al Qaeda.

The communiqué, whose authenticity hasn't been established, pays homage to Emir Abu Hamza Al-Muhajer (new chief of the Iraqi branch of Al Qaeda) for having applied the decision of the tribunal for sharia" concerning the two American soldiers.

From CNN (Fixed):

"We spotted what we believe to be them late last night, as it was dark," said Caldwell, who initially refused to confirm or deny whether the bodies were believed to be those of the soldiers -- or even whether two bodies had been found. (Watch sad end to desperate search for soldiers -- 1:31)

"Not knowing for sure, we went ahead and established a cordon around the area to protect it, so it would be undisturbed until daylight this morning."

At dawn, explosives teams and other assets were brought in for the recovery effort, he said. Insurgents previously have complicated recovery efforts by booby-trapping the areas around bodies.

"They did have to dismantle some stuff to get to them," Caldwell said.
